It is not always easy to find a pleasant spot for a coffee or a snack in German pedestrian zones and shopping areas. The city centre seems to be dominated by chains of stores and restaurants. But don't worry - if you are longing for a short break from shopping or sightseeing, Funkhaus is always a good idea. It is a café, bar and restaurant all in one and was so called due to its direct proximity to the WDR broadcasting studios.
The atmosphere is busy and metropolitan. Journalists, speakers, artists, business people, shoppers and tourists are constantly coming in and going out. The menu is wide-ranging from breakfast and a menu of the day, cakes, snacks up to a wide selection of wines and cocktails.
What I like most is the decoration - there are many details like murals, lamps and old black and white pictures from the 1950s and 1960s and the waiters are formally dressed. The bar is apparently not vintage, but fits perfectly with the rest of the interior and is nicely illuminated.
